js字符串替换为换行
时间: 2024-06-08 19:12:34 浏览: 15
可以使用 JavaScript 的 replace 方法来实现字符串的替换为换行符。你可以使用正则表达式 `/\\n/g` 来匹配字符串中的所有换行符,并使用 `\n` 来替换它们。下面是一个示例代码:
```javascript
const str = "这是一个\n示例字符串\n用于替换";
const replacedStr = str.replace(/\n/g, "\n");
console.log(replacedStr);
```
运行上述代码,它会将字符串中的所有 `\n` 替换为换行符,并输出结果:
```
这是一个
示例字符串
用于替换
```
希望能帮到你!如有更多问题,请随时提问。
相关问题
div中js编程让长字符串换行
你可以在 JavaScript 中使用字符串的换行符 `\n` 来实现长字符串的换行。然后,你可以将这个字符串插入到 HTML 的 div 元素中,使其在页面上换行显示。下面是一个示例代码:
```html
<div id="myDiv"></div>
<script>
var longString = "Lorem ipsum dolor sit amet, consectetur adipiscing elit. Praesent eget nunc leo. Vestibulum ante ipsum primis in faucibus orci luctus et ultrices posuere cubilia curae; Sed egestas sapien non rutrum imperdiet. Quisque non ante vel ante ornare malesuada sit amet id sapien. Proin convallis, nulla quis iaculis maximus, ex ante auctor magna, eu finibus felis tortor in nisi. Suspendisse id tortor vel sem fermentum vestibulum. Sed ac purus vel augue rhoncus elementum. Nam vel velit id erat rhoncus sagittis nec et mauris.";
var formattedString = longString.replace(/\n/g, "<br>");
document.getElementById("myDiv").innerHTML = formattedString;
</script>
```
在这个例子中,我们首先定义了一个长字符串 `longString`,然后使用字符串的 `replace` 方法将其中的换行符 `\n` 替换为 HTML 的换行标签 `<br>`。最后,我们将格式化后的字符串插入到 `myDiv` 元素中。
uniapp 字符串 换行
在uniapp中,你可以使用模板字符串进行字符串的换行。模板字符串使用ES6反引号(``)界定,并使用`${}`来嵌入变量。例如,你可以使用`\n`来表示换行。可以使用字符串的`replace`方法来将`\n`替换为实际的换行符。以下是一个示例代码:
```javascript
let name = 'Hello\nWorld';
let formattedString = `My name is ${name.replace(/\\n/g, '\n')}`;
console.log(formattedString);
// 输出结果:
// My name is Hello
// World
```
在这个示例中,我们首先定义了一个包含换行的字符串`Hello\nWorld`。然后使用模板字符串将其嵌入到另一个字符串中,并使用`replace`方法将`\n`替换为实际的换行符。最后,打印出格式化后的字符串,结果为`My name is Hello\nWorld`。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[uni-app开发微信小程序数据 \n 换行符失效问题](https://blog.csdn.net/loveliqi/article/details/124425868)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[字符串 · uni-app跨平台移动应用开发 · 看云](https://blog.csdn.net/weixin_35002851/article/details/111952869)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v93^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
相关推荐
![txt](https://img-home.csdnimg.cn/images/20210720083642.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)